Diagnose und medikamentöse Therapie der chronischen Herzinsuffizienz in der hausärztlichen Praxis

Abstract

Heart failure (HF) is an important clinical syndrome in outpatient and inpatient care with treatment costs accounting for approximately 2% of all health care expenditures in Germany. Since many symptoms of HF are nonspecific, the initial diagnosis is often made in consultations with family practitioners. A diagnostic algorithm for the low prevalence patient population of family practice is based on the National Treatment Guideline “Chronic Heart Failure” (NVL-HF). It takes into account clinical signs and symptoms as well as risk factors to aid decisions on further laboratory diagnostics (NT-pro-BNP) and/or echocardiography. Guideline-directed medical therapy after diagnosis of HI is based on the reduction in left ventricular ejection fraction and NYHA stages. It consists of prognostic agents and an additive diuretic therapy to attenuate symptoms of volume overload.
